Artist Biography
Canadian country outfit James Barker Band started their recording career with seven consecutive Top 10 hits—with six of them certified either Gold or Platinum.
∙ Before scoring a record deal, the band won the 2015 Emerging Artist Showcase at Boots and Hearts, Canada’s largest country music festival.
∙ 2016’s “Lawn Chair Lazy” hit No. 3 on the Canadian Country Airplay chart, setting that chart’s record for the highest-charting debut single.
∙ “Chills,” the band’s breakthrough single, won two 2018 Canadian Country Music Association awards: Single of the Year and Top Selling Canadian Single of the Year.
∙ The Platinum-selling crossover hit “Keep It Simple”—from the band’s 2019 sophomore release, Singles Only—was their first to make the Top 40 radio and Canadian pop charts.
